The Gentleman's Code - Part II

The second rule to be entered into The Gentleman's Code is as follows;
"A gentleman shall only say 'I love you,' when it is meant, and not simply to get him places.
It is good to get places, but there are other ways to do so that are more 'gentlemanly.' Words are powerful, and should be used appropriately."

Again, not a designated Rule II, but it is the second rule entered.
